1. Optimize Product Pages

Product pages are the backbone of any e-commerce website. They’re where customers make purchasing decisions, and they’re crucial for conversions. To optimize product pages, make sure to:

  • Use high-quality product images and videos
  • Write detailed and descriptive product descriptions
  • Highlight key features and benefits
  • Include customer reviews and ratings
  • Make sure the page is mobile-friendly and loads quickly

2. Streamline Checkout Process

A long and complicated checkout process can be a major turn-off for customers. To streamline the checkout process, consider:

  • Reducing the number of steps in the checkout process
  • Offering guest checkout options
  • Allowing customers to save their payment and shipping information for future use
  • Providing clear and concise instructions throughout the process

3. Use Urgency Tactics

Creating a sense of urgency can be a powerful way to drive conversions. Try using tactics like:

  • Limited-time offers and promotions
  • Countdown timers for limited-time sales
  • Scarcity messaging (e.g. "Only X left in stock")
  • Free shipping or other incentives for timely purchases

4. Leverage Social Proof

Social proof is a powerful way to build trust and credibility with customers. Consider:

  • Displaying customer reviews and ratings prominently on product pages
  • Using customer testimonials in marketing campaigns
  • Featuring customer stories and success stories on your website
  • Encouraging customers to share their experiences on social media

5. Optimize for Mobile

With more and more customers shopping on their mobile devices, it’s crucial to optimize your website for mobile. Make sure to:

  • Ensure your website is responsive and looks great on mobile devices
  • Optimize images and videos for mobile devices
  • Streamline the checkout process for mobile devices
  • Use mobile-specific marketing campaigns and promotions

6. Use A/B Testing

A/B testing is a powerful way to optimize your website and drive conversions. Try testing different elements, such as:

  • Headlines and product descriptions
  • Product images and videos
  • Call-to-action buttons and messaging
  • Checkout process and payment options

7. Offer Personalized Recommendations

Personalized recommendations can help customers find products they’ll love and increase conversions. Consider:

  • Using machine learning algorithms to suggest products based on customer behavior and preferences
  • Offering personalized product recommendations on product pages and in email marketing campaigns
  • Creating personalized product bundles and offers

8. Use Email Marketing

Email marketing is a powerful way to drive conversions and retain customers. Consider:

  • Sending targeted and personalized email campaigns to customers
  • Offering exclusive promotions and discounts to email subscribers
  • Using email marketing automation to send triggered emails based on customer behavior

9. Optimize for Search Engines

Search engine optimization (SEO) is crucial for driving organic traffic and conversions. Make sure to:

  • Use relevant and descriptive keywords on product pages and throughout your website
  • Optimize product titles, descriptions, and meta tags
  • Use internal linking to help search engines understand your website’s structure
  • Monitor and adjust your SEO strategy regularly

10. Analyze and Optimize

Finally, it’s crucial to analyze and optimize your website regularly. Use tools like Google Analytics to track key metrics, such as:

  • Conversion rates and revenue
  • Bounce rates and exit rates
  • Average order value and customer lifetime value
  • Mobile and desktop traffic
